2.52€This is a time-lag fuse designed for surface-mount devices (SMD), rated at 750mA and 125V. The fuse features a ceramic casing, which provides durability and heat resistance. The time-lag characteristic means the fuse allows for temporary overcurrent without blowing, making it suitable for circuits with inrush currents or transient spikes. The case size is 2410, and it is identified with the code 454.

3.32€This is a time-lag fuse with a 7.5A current rating, designed to protect circuits from overcurrent. The fuse is rated for both 125VAC (Alternating Current) and 125VDC (Direct Current), making it versatile for use in both AC and DC circuits. It features a ceramic body, which provides durability and heat resistance, and copper terminals for excellent electrical conductivity. The fuse is designed for SMD (Surface-Mount Device) mounting, allowing it to be easily integrated into modern, compact electronics.

1.65€This is a quick blow fuse designed to protect electrical circuits from overcurrent. The fuse has a rating of 8A and can handle a maximum voltage of 250VAC. It features a ceramic body, which provides durability and heat resistance, and brass terminals for better conductivity. The fuse comes in a 5x20mm size, commonly used in many electronic and electrical applications. The FCD marking indicates the specific fuse series, and the fuse is sold in bulk, not in individual packaging.

2.10€This is a PMIC (Power Management Integrated Circuit), specifically a DC/DC converter designed to step down the input voltage to a stable output. The input voltage range is 8V to 40V, and the output voltage is 5V with a current output capacity of 3A. It comes in a TO263-5 package, which is a Surface-Mount Device (SMD) with five pins, offering efficient heat dissipation and a compact form factor for power management applications. The converter operates with a switching frequency of 150kHz, which ensures efficiency while minimizing losses. It is commonly used in applications requiring voltage regulation and power efficiency, such as power supplies, battery-powered devices, and more.
